Spellbinders April Small Die of the Month

Hello there.  I’m popping in today to share a thank you card made with the April Spellbinders Small Die of the Month.  This month is called Stitched Thanks and consists of seven dies - one large main die with the stitching holes and six letters to spell “thanks”.  It’s perfectly sized for a slimline card.

I have wanted to give stitching a try for a couple of years now and even bought the supplies back then.  Sadly, they have been collecting dust ever since. 🙈   So when I couldn’t find or remember where I kept them, I was so bummed.  I thought about buying the supplies again, but this die set can be used with or without stitching.  But as luck would have it, I found them last night just as I was about to post!  Here’s my card.


Being this is my first time stitching, I felt stitching the full die (which is gorgeous btw) would be a bit daunting.  So I went in a completely different direction, taking different parts and created stitched embellishment pieces for my card.


4 pieces of the one on the left above were overlapped and the holes aligned to form the large blue flower.  The piece on the right created the purple flower. 


This is a mini slimline card; another first for me.  A piece of Bristol paper was trimmed to 6”x3”.  The top and bottom were dry embossed with the large main die to give it some texture.  The letters were die cut from black cardstock and silver foil paper and offset for a shadow effect.  Assembled the card onto a 6”x3” white card base and added glitter enamel dots from Your Next Stamp Enchanted Garden Sparkly Gumdrops to finish.
